Hybrid vehicles have become increasingly popular over the years due to their fuel efficiency and eco-friendly nature. One of the key components of a hybrid vehicle is the hybrid battery, which powers the electric motor alongside the internal combustion engine. However, like any other battery, hybrid batteries can degrade over time and eventually need to be replaced.


When it comes to hybrid battery cell replacement, there are a few important things to consider. First and foremost, it's essential to understand the different types of battery cells used in hybrid vehicles. Most hybrid batteries are made up of nickel-metal hydride (NiMH) cells or lithium-ion cells. NiMH cells are commonly found in older hybrid models, while newer models often use lithium-ion cells due to their higher energy density and longer lifespan.


If your hybrid vehicle's battery is showing signs of degradation, such as decreased fuel efficiency or a warning light on the dashboard, it may be time to consider replacing the battery cells. One option is to purchase a replacement battery from the manufacturer, although this can be quite expensive. Another option is to opt for reconditioned battery cells, which are used cells that have been refurbished to meet like-new performance standards. Reconditioned battery cells are a more affordable alternative to buying a brand-new battery and can help extend the lifespan of your hybrid vehicle.


Before replacing the battery cells in your hybrid vehicle, it's important to consult with a professional mechanic or dealership to ensure that you're choosing the right type of cells for your specific vehicle model. Additionally, be sure to inquire about the warranty options for replacement battery cells, as some manufacturers offer warranties on reconditioned cells to provide peace of mind to consumers.


When it comes to actually replacing the battery cells, it's recommended to have the work done by a trained technician who specializes in hybrid vehicles. Replacing hybrid battery cells can be a complicated and delicate process, so it's best to leave it to the experts to ensure that the job is done correctly and safely.
